Gergely Kulcsár (10 March 1934 – 12 August 2020) a Hungarian javelin thrower. He competed at the 1960, 1964, 1968 and 1972 Olympics and won two bronze medals, in 1960 and 1968, and a silver medal in 1964.[2]
He was the Olympic flag bearer for Hungary in 1964, 1968 and 1972.
